Output 39e3d12105be45836def6486a041b7af2da37ce7a15c0fadf337dcd71352e838:1

value
19659706
script pubkey
OP_0 OP_PUSHBYTES_20 376ccb08eee022f83801dec82f46d30a21bea757
address
ltc1qxakvkz8wuq30swqpmmyz73knpgsmaf6h5kpr0q
transaction
39e3d12105be45836def6486a041b7af2da37ce7a15c0fadf337dcd71352e838
spent
true